Initial AWS-compatible CloudWatch API implementation
Supports the following API actions:
- DescribeAlarms : describe alarm/watch details
- ListMetrics : List watch metric datapoints
- PutMetricData : Create metric datapoint
- SetAlarmState : temporarily set alarm state

Skeleton implementation of all other TODO actions which
returns HeatAPINotImplementedError.

Only basic filtering parameters supported at this time.

HEAT

This is an OpenStack style project that provides a REST API to orchestrate multiple cloud applications implementing well-known standards such as AWS CloudFormation and TOSCA.

Currently the developers are focusing on AWS CloudFormation but are watching the development of the TOSCA specification.

Why heat? It makes the clouds rise and keeps them there.
